On March 3, 2025, President Nayib Bukele announced the purchase of additional Bitcoin, increasing the country's holdings to 6,100 BTC, raising concerns for the IMF.
El Salvador and Bitcoin Acquisition
El Salvador's ongoing acquisition of Bitcoin continues to spark debates within international financial circles. Reports indicate that the country has increased its holdings, challenging the compliance with commitments made to the International Monetary Fund (IMF).
Debate on Sovereignty and Financial Stability
The decision has rekindled the debate surrounding the acceptance of cryptocurrency at the sovereign state level. Proponents argue that this move could stimulate the economy, while critics warn of potential financial instability due to Bitcoin's volatility.
